Shape recognition is a foundational skill in early mathematics for children ages 4-8, and it should be a priority for parents and teachers alike. Understanding shapes is not merely about identifying circles, squares, and triangles; it forms the basis for more complex geometric concepts that children will encounter later in their education. Shape recognition fosters critical thinking and problem-solving skills, enabling young learners to make connections between shapes and the physical world around them.
Additionally, mastering shape recognition can enhance spatial awareness, which is essential for activities ranging from reading maps to understanding architecture. Early exposure to shapes contributes to cognitive development, as children learn to categorize and compare different objects. Engaging activities related to shape recognition can also promote fine motor skills through hands-on experiences like drawing, cutting, and constructing shapes.
Moreover, the skills developed through shape recognition lay the groundwork for advanced topics, such as measurement and data, reinforcing the importance of numeracy. When parents and teachers prioritize shape recognition, they are equipping children with vital tools for future academic success while nurturing their enthusiasm for learning. Ultimately, caring for this essential aspect of early math education supports holistic development in young learners.
